1. 使用aes-128-cbc算法加密文件: openssl enc -aes-128-cbc -in install.log -out enc.log (注:这里install.log是你想要加密的文件,enc.log是加密后的文件,回车后系统会提示你输入口令) 2. 解密刚刚加密的文件: openssl enc -d -aes-128-cbc -in enc.log -out install.log (注:enc.log是刚刚加密...
openssl enc -ciphername[-in filename] [-out filename] [-pass arg] [-e] [-d] [-a/-base64] [-A] [-k password] [-kfile filename] [-K key] [-iv IV] [-S salt] [-salt] [-nosalt] [-z] [-md] [-p] [-P] [-bufsize number] [-nopad] [-debug] [-none] [-engine ...
. |opensslenc -aes128-d -K <key> -iv<initialization vector>中使用OpenSSL1.1.0g时,该操作在解密大部分字符串后出现“数字信封如果我加上‘-nopad’,那么它就完全工作 浏览0提问于2019-03-11得票数0 1回答 从Ruby到NodeJS的带摘要的CBC 、 我正在尝试解码一个用Ruby编码的字符串,如下所示:req...
1、使用aes-128-cbc算法加密文件: openssl enc -aes-128-cbc -in install.log -out enc.log (注:这里install.log是你想要加密的文件,enc.log是加密后的文件,回车后系统会提示你输入密码。) 2、解密刚才加密的文件: openssl enc -d -aes-128-cbc -in enc.log -out install.log (注:enc.log是刚才加密...
openssl enc 算法 -e -in 源文件名 -out 输出文件名 -k 密码 eg: openssl enc -aes-128-ecb -e -in a.tar.gz -out a.bin -k 12345678 解密 openssl enc 算法 -d -in 源文件名 -out 输出文件名 -k 密码 eg: openssl enc -aes-128-ecb -d -in a.bin -out a.tar.gz -k 12345678 ...
openssl enc -d -aes-128-ecb -in ${FILE_NAME}.enc -out ${FILE_NAME} -pass pass:passw0rd -p 3、批量文件压缩、加解密操作 代码语言:txt 复制 #压缩并加密一组文件如x、y,生成文件xy tar cvfz - x y | openssl enc -e -aes-128-ecb -out xy -pass pass:passw0rd ...
如果我们想知道某一个加密算法的使用,如我们查一下aes-128-ecb使用,可以在终端输入命令:openssl aes-128-ecb -help image.png 1、对称加密 对称加密需要使用的标准命令为 enc ,用法如下: 常用选项有: -in filename:指定要加密的文件存放路径 -out filename:指定加密后的文件存放路径 ...
OpenSSL命令行AES-BASE64加密问题 条件 明文:123456789abcdef0 密钥:helloaeshelloaes 68656c6c6f61657368656c6c6f616573是helloaeshelloaes十六进制 命令行 从文件plain.txt中取明文,加密后密文写入cipher.txt openssl enc -aes-128-ecb -in plain.txt -out cipher.txt -K 68656c6c6f61657368656c6c6f616573 ...
要进行解密,需要以下OpenSSL语句: openssl enc -in doc-encrypted.docx -out doc-decryted.docx -d -aes-256-ofb -K 5445535450415353574f5244313233345445535450415353574f524431323334 -iv 00000000000000000000000000000000 -K选项指定十六进制编码的密钥,-iv指定十六进制加密的iv,s.enc。 通过此更改,可以使用OpenSSL语句对...
enc - 对称加密例程,使用对称密钥对数据进行加解密,特点是速度快,能对大量数据进行处理。算法有流算法和分组加密算法,流算法是逐字节加密,数据经典算法,但由于其容易被破译,现在已很少使用;分组加密算法是将数据分成固定大小的组里,然后逐组进行加密,比较广为人知的是DES3。分组算法中又有ECB,CBC,CFB,OFB,CTR等工...